- Jasper Beach: Jasper Beach is a picturesque beach with unique characteristics. It is known for its stunning pebble shoreline, which is unlike any other beach in the area. The smooth, round stones create a mesmerizing mosaic of colors, ranging from vibrant reds and blues to earthy browns and grays. Walking along the beach feels like strolling on a natural work of art. The sound of the waves crashing against the pebbles adds to the serene atmosphere. Jasper Beach is the perfect place to relax, unwind, and enjoy the beauty of nature. Whether you're collecting colorful stones or simply soaking in the peaceful ambiance, this beach provides a truly distinctive and tranquil beach experience.

The travel seasons of Machiasport
Trips to Machiasport show a noticeable change in popularity throughout the year. The peak season to visit is from June to August, with July being the highest month. Off-peak season starts from October to December, and November sees the least travelers.
Machiasport has something in store for you whenever you visit. January is the coldest month of the year, while August is hottest, with average temperatures up to 64.8 degrees Fahrenheit. The wettest month in Machiasport is December, so pack accordingly.
